The Challenge of Rural Connectivity

Mobile network operators in Africa are facing a dual challenge. On one hand, there is a growing demand from governments to ensure universal coverage, compelling operators to extend their networks to even the most remote areas. On the other hand, the economics of traditional terrestrial infrastructure make it financially unfeasible to invest in regions with low population density and low Average Revenue Per User (ARPU).

As highlighted by statistics, there exists a significant disparity in mobile density across African countries, with some regions lagging far behind others. While urban centers enjoy 3G and 4G connectivity, rural areas often lack even basic mobile coverage. This digital divide not only hampers economic development but also exacerbates social inequalities.

The Promise of Satellite Solutions

Satellite technology presents a compelling solution to the challenges of rural connectivity in Africa. Unlike terrestrial infrastructure, satellites offer flexible, scalable, and cost-effective means to extend mobile networks to remote regions. With their wide coverage areas and dynamic point-to-multipoint links, satellites enable operators to connect dispersed rural communities within the same footprint.

One of the key advantages of satellite backhauling is its ability to provide shared bandwidth among multiple sites, optimizing resource utilization and reducing operational costs. Moreover, satellite-based solutions are not constrained by geographical barriers, making them ideal for reaching isolated areas where terrestrial connectivity is impractical.

Empowering Rural Communities

By leveraging satellite technology, mobile network operators can extend their services to previously unconnected rural communities, thereby fulfilling their universal service obligations. This expansion of connectivity opens up a myriad of opportunities for economic growth, social development, and empowerment.

Economic Opportunities

Mobile connectivity serves as a catalyst for economic activities in rural areas. It enables faster and easier communication, facilitates e-commerce and mobile payments, and fosters entrepreneurship. With access to mobile networks, rural communities can engage in agricultural marketing, access financial services, and participate in the digital economy.

Social Development

Beyond economic benefits, mobile connectivity enhances access to essential services such as healthcare and education. Telemedicine initiatives leverage mobile networks to deliver healthcare services to remote patients, improving health outcomes and reducing disparities in healthcare access. Similarly, mobile-based educational platforms enable distance learning and skill development, empowering individuals to enhance their livelihoods.

Environmental Sustainability

Satellite-based solutions for rural connectivity offer environmental benefits as well. By utilizing solar energy to power remote sites, these solutions reduce reliance on fossil fuels and contribute to environmental sustainability. Moreover, the low maintenance requirements of solar-powered infrastructure minimize operational costs and ensure long-term viability.
